Cheticamp is a cute town that is pretty small.

Cheticamp is a cute town that is pretty small. Try to find live fiddling music, which we did at Doryman's Pub. The area is also known for rug hooking and there are two shops that specialize in those products. There are a couple of cute restaurants that offer good food, the Seagull being one.

A number of good restaurants.

A number of good restaurants. Local people very helpful and friendly. Gorgeous area including many sites outside of the nearby National Park. Local sites include Gypsum Lake, Cheticamp Island ( causeway access). Harbour Restaurant and Seafood Stop good - plain and simple good Pizza - Pizza Shack - liked veggie explosion. Mr Chicken great for ice cream - only tried the ice cream - small was bigger than we expected. Abundant attractions beyond town.
